Transaction ecf1683a060dce84cec379f30e4f0a3eda9447a63daa10d4260b4faca6418e9a
1 Input
1 Output
-
ecf1683a060dce84cec379f30e4f0a3eda9447a63daa10d4260b4faca6418e9a:0
- value
- 101412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ff2cf3d29367213b4d2c12c84ef9af4252a91e OP_EQUAL
- address
- 354dwMt94bB9hhruH27BPygCvemkSbT5ES